When it works it works great for my needs. The problem is: the power button is SO SO SO easy to get activated accidentally. This will leave you with a false confidence. I've gotten where I need to, age charging the night before, only to find out is been drained on the drive there, because of how incredibly too easy it is to turn on. Aside from that, it's very handy to use with my CPAP. Lost the 2 stars because camping without a cpap is not fun or restful. Read more

The power capacity for this power station is not bad, however I’ve already taken it on 2 trips and the on/off button seems to be a problem. I stored it back in it’s original box and took it out only to find it turned on. I didn’t think much off it at the time, but this occurred again when I took it on a 2nd trip. The unit turned on again while being stored in the box. It seems only the slightest contact with the power button will turn on the unit. You essentially need to store it and carry it where there’s nothing coming into contact with the power button, which is somewhat annoying. On the first use 1/2 the power was gone because it turned on inside the box. The second use a similar situation happened and was left with 1/4 power. In short, I don’t like the transportability of this unit. There need to be a firm on/off switch or an auto off option when not in use to save power. Considering returning and would not recommend. Seems like a silly reason, but power button is too sensitive and defeats the purpose of having a power station when you go to use it only to find it turned on or left on and not plugged into anything and all the power is gone. I don’t have this issue with my other smaller power banks, only this model. Read more
